Operations Supervisor
Drive efficient operations as a supervisor at a leading Glass & Aluminium company. Oversee staff, inventory, and dispatch, with strong organisational and leadership skills required.
What You Should Know About This Offer
This Operations Supervisor role is a full-time position offering a market-related salary. The job offers on-site responsibilities within a well-established firm.
The contract is permanent, making it a reliable choice for those wanting stability. Candidates will work in a supportive environment with room to lead and innovate.
Job duties include dispatch management, quality control, inventory oversight, and staff supervision. Leadership and attention to detail are highly valued in this role.
Applicants should have at least two years’ experience in warehouse, retail, or operations, with a minimum of one year in a supervisory position.
Being trustworthy with a strong sense of responsibility is crucial. Experience with systems like Office and SAGE (Pastel) is a definite plus.
Daily Tasks and Responsibilities
The Operations Supervisor is tasked with managing order fulfilment, ensuring every order is dispatched accurately and punctually.
Inventory control requires precise stock management and strong mental maths skills for regular counts and reconciliation.
Staff leadership duties involve motivating the team, overseeing schedules, and fostering a positive work environment.
Quality control is essential, involving regular checks to maintain the company’s reputation for excellence in every product shipped out.
Business continuity depends on the supervisor’s problem-solving and decisive decision-making, ensuring smooth daily operations even during unexpected challenges.
